Annual revenue at risk is the total revenue lost because emails never reach their destination. Every email that lands in spam or goes missing is a missed conversion opportunity.
Monthly recovery potential is the incremental revenue you'd gain by reaching MailMonitor's guaranteed 90% inbox placement rate. If you're already at or above 90%, this is $0.
ROI calculation compares the revenue recovered at 90% inbox placement against the cost of the recommended MailMonitor tier. Net gain = revenue recovered minus MailMonitor investment.
